The International Public Careers Minor*** (Political Science Majors)

Courses to be taken in major: 30 hours

PO 1311 American National Government

PO 1312 Texas State and Local Government (or PO 1314 Understanding Politics)

PO 3321 Public Administration

PO 3342 20th Century Political Thought

PO 3360 Topics in International/Comparative Politics

PO 3361 International Relations

PO 4368 Politics of International and Political Economy

PO 4369 Politics of World Security Problems

PO 4370 United States Foreign Policy

PO 5300 Internship in Political Science

Courses to be taken in minor: 21 hours
EC 3302 World Economic Geography
EC 3310 (or IB 3310) International Economics
IB 3321 U.S. Business in an Interdependent World
IB 4358 Global Operations Management
Plus six (6) additional hours from the following, depending on international focus:
HS 4302, 4306, 4322, 4330, 4342, 5314, 5324
***For Social Science requirement in the Core Curriculum, SC 1311, EC 2301 and EC 2303 are to be taken.

The International Public Careers Minor**** (Non-Political Science Majors)

Courses to be taken in minor: 21 hours
PO 3321 Public Administration
PO 5300 Internship in Political Science
Plus nine (9) hours from the following
PO 2310 Political Science Methodology
PO 3330 Topics in Law
PO 3343 20th Century Political Thought
PO 3360 Topics in International/Comparative Politics
PO 3362 European Politics
PO 3363 Latin American Politics
PO 4368 International Political Economy
PO 4369 World Security Problems
PO 4370 U.S. Foreign Policy
Plus six (6) hours from the following, depending on international focus:
EC 3302 World Economic Geography
EC 3310 International Economics
HS 4302, 4306, 4322, 4330, 4342, 5314, 5324
****For Social Science requirement in the Core Curriculum, PO 1311 and 1312 or 1314, SC 1311, and EC 2301 are to be taken.
